The Four Pillars Of Creating A Strong Digital Economy

Currently, the digital economy is a crucial part of the economy of any country, and it is essential to know how it can be strengthened to boost a country’s economy further. Even though many factors play a crucial role in uplifting the economy, the essential pillars include infrastructure, society, innovation, and technology adoption, and jobs.

Measuring different data is essential as it provides the necessary information to guide policymakers in designing the right policy to bring about positive changes in a country. In most countries, many gaps still exist between these pillars, and filling them can help to create a robust digital economy. Let us now dive into the details.

Infrastructure

In regards to infrastructure, developing a robust broadband communication network is a must. Working on the infrastructure alone can improve the financial, health, and educational sectors. Working on the infrastructure requires a high amount of investment. Therefore, it is natural to find a strong correlation between the fixed broadband penetration of a country and GDP per capita. 

Also, building the internet infrastructure is not enough; working towards a higher internet speed is equally crucial. Society 

The internet, without which creating a digital economy is impossible, is now an indispensable part of society. When considering society, it is of prime importance to draw a small focus on the students who are the pillars of any country. It is essential to narrow down the existing digital divide to include society. To eliminate the digital divide, it is essential to understand that age and the educator factor, along with income level, play a critical role in internet uptake in any society.

Developing ICT skills is important to ensure that everyone knows how to use internet-based services. The foundation of the same should be laid down right at the school. Furthermore, companies can also work towards it by providing regular training to the workforce. Another way of including the entire society in the digital transformation is by providing digital government services. It not only removes the manual load but also makes things easier for the citizen due to accessibility. 

Innovation and Technology Adoption

Technology has been developing with each passing day. Most technology improves the output of any business or educational institution. It is particularly true with the advent of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ning. AI-related technology is particularly disruptive and it is bringing disruption for good. 

Not many companies are accustomed to the newly available technology. However, to compete with global firms and offer services to global clients, it is necessary to adopt innovation and technology as soon as possible.

Furthermore, the government should invest in research and development as it is the key to innovation. A proper contribution can only be made when public and private stakeholders come together to bring the required changes. In most developed nations, the business sector plays a significant role in research and development. 

Jobs And Growth

The information industry is blooming in a manner that it is now an essential source of economic growth in any country. Many businesses adopting technology and innovation are still growing, playing a crucial role in bringing job growth to the country. Employment in the IT sector is increasing steadily in the G20 countries. 

Overall, the digital economy is creating new markets, and additionally, it is creating new job opportunities and increasing employment. However, at the same time, it presents a risk of unemployment, especially for people who are not skilled enough. Therefore, governments and organizations must ensure that the labor market remains inclusive.

The digital economy is growing at an unprecedented rate, and every country should work towards it to undergo the much-required digital transformation. It is changing the economy’s structure and creating new market opportunities, which is essential for economic growth. However, while growing the digital economy, it is vital for the government to ensure that the growth is inclusive. Without considering both pros and cons of the digital economy, working toward sustainable development is difficult.
